CD 1728 Fear Bows to Peace
Fear is of the devil, and fear brings torment ( see *1 John 4:18). One of the names of the devil is the Tormentor (see *Matthew 18:34)! Many people are bound by fear, and they are in great pain and discomfort! There is a lie to hold them back, but praise God, there's a truth that makes one free!
*John 20:19-20 KJVS - 19 Then the same day at evening, being the first day of the week, when the doors were shut where the disciples were assembled for fear of the Jews, came Jesus and stood in the midst, and saith unto them, Peace be unto you.
20 And when he had so said, he shewed unto them his hands and his side. Then were the disciples glad, when they saw the Lord.
Notice the disciples were bound by fear, but then the Lord Jesus came to where they were with a message just for thrm! He said Peace be unto you! His peace is a direct opposite of the fear they were feeling. It was a fear you could cut with a knife! But even though He had told them peace be unto them, they had to see Jesus' resurrected body for themselves to be able to receive His peace! Notice it's chapter 20 verse 20, so 20/20 vision of Jesus is what brings His peace and drives out the world's fear. Because it says when the disciples saw for themselves what He went through on the cross then they were glad! It's not knowing that yes there was a Jesus historically and there was a cross it's seeing that He went to that cross for you personally!
Let's dive deeper on Fear:
* 2 Timothy 1:7: "For God hath not given us the spirit of fear; but of power, and of love, and of a sound mind."
* This verse directly states that fear is not from God, contrasting it with the gifts He does give: power, love, and a disciplined mind.
* Psalm 56:3: "What time I am afraid, I will trust in thee."
* A simple yet powerful declaration of faith in the face of fear.
* Isaiah 41:10: "Fear thou not; for I am with thee: be not dismayed; for I am thy God: I will strengthen thee; yea, I will help thee; yea, I will uphold thee with the right hand of my righteousness."
* God's promise to be present, to strengthen, help, and uphold His people, dispelling fear.
* Psalm 23:4: "Yea, though I walk through the valley of the shadow of death, I will fear no evil: for thou art with me; thy rod and thy staff they comfort me."
* Even in the darkest moments, the presence of God provides comfort and removes fear. We mentioned this verse in the opening but let's study it now:
* 1 John 4:18: "There is no fear in love; but perfect love casteth out fear: because fear hath torment. He that feareth is not made perfect in love."
* This is a foundational verse, indicating that genuine love for God, which is perfected in us, expels fear because fear itself is a torment.
* Proverbs 29:25: "The fear of man bringeth a snare: but whoso putteth his trust in the LORD shall be safe."
* Contrasts the danger of fearing people with the safety found in trusting God.
Now let's get back to the Peace of Jesus Christ and how fear must bow
:
* John 14:27: "Peace I leave with you, my peace I give unto you: not as the world giveth, give I unto you. Let not your heart be troubled, neither let it be afraid."
* Jesus directly gives His peace, a peace distinct from worldly peace, to calm troubled hearts and banish fear.
* John 16:33: "These things I have spoken unto you, that in me ye might have peace. In the world ye shall have tribulation: but be of good cheer; I have overcome the world."
